## Formula sandbox tuning

User-supplied formulas in Gridmoor execute inside a restricted interpreter with hard ceilings on time, memory, and call depth. Reviewers should confirm any change to these ceilings is justified in the PR description, since raising them widens the abuse surface. Defaults were chosen from production traces. The current limits are as follows.

limits module of tafog-fawip:
WEIGHTS = {
    "julix": 57,
    "lamys": 992,
    "kasvan": 209,
    "quenok": 750,
    "alddor": 259,
    "oliath": 1009,
    "wenix": 815,
}

Sweeper runbook — Dellforge retention service. The sweeper deletes records past policy age in the Kestwick archive tier, running nightly at 02:00. Before any manual invocation, confirm legal-hold flags are synced; the sweeper honors holds but a stale sync can cause premature deletion. Dry-run mode writes a manifest of candidate rows without deleting; security review should inspect that manifest for scope creep. All deletions are logged immutably for 90 days. When filing an audit request, include the trace token printed at sweep start.

trace token, fafog-kageg: htk4_98e6

Diligence closes this quarter; completion targeted for early next. Actions: HR to finalise transfer lists; Legal to clear the supplier novations; Finance to ring-fence Tarnbrook accounts by month-end. Shared services wind down over two quarters. External messaging remains embargoed until signing — refer all enquiries to the programme office. No impact on the Caldmere or Westrow units. The confidential note appended below sets out the post-sale investment plan.

management briefing: Gross margin on Ralwyn came in at 5 percent against a plan of 5 percent. Only 3 of the 120 pilot accounts renewed Ralwyn, so a churn review is set for January 1.